August 10-14, 2011 IRCHA (International Radio Controlled Helicopter Association) AMA Headquarters Muncie, IN

This "Happening" is all about helicopters.  You can watch pro's fly or compete along with manufacture's demos.  There is also a very long flight line where anyone can fly their "machine".

June 3 - June 5, 2011 XFC (Extreme Flight Competition) AMA Headquarters Muncie, IN

This yearly event has both airplane and helicopter competition of some of the best pilots around.  Competition runs Friday through Sunday and includes night flying on Saturday and awards on Sunday.

April 2, 2011 ETOC

Wow, what fun to watch some of the worlds best RC pilots put a 4-5oz foamy plane through its paces.  The Electric Tournament of Champions runs in the evening of the Weak Signals (Toledo Show) RC Model Show, Friday and Saturday.  The ETOC takes place in a local high school about a 7 minute drive from Seagate Convention Center.  There is precision flight and freestyle flying to music.  For more information about the ETOC, visit...

2010 Duxford aviation museum - (From Milton)

I visited the Duxford aviation museum back in September while I was traveling in Europe. Attached are some pictures including planes in the restoration phase.  They also have a large American hanger which included a B-52 bomber and SR-71 but these can be seen in Dayton and I did not include any pictures of American planes. There is also a gas powered (two 110 cc engines) 17 foot wingspan RC warbird that was in one of the hangers. I included a picture identifying the specs of this RC warbird. The museum, grounds, and airfield were awesome.

November 7th and 8th, 2009 JR Indoor Electric Festival, Columbus Ohio

Alex and Al made the Journey to Columbus on Saturday to partake in this event.  Alex flew his new MX-2 foam model while I took pictures.  We also met the designer of the MX-2, RJ Gritter.  The MX-2 took first place at this years E-TOC (Toledo) while being flown by Seth Arnold.  RJ, Seth, Jamie Hicks, Andrew Jesky, Nick Maxwell and many other premier pilots were at this event.  If you are interested in the MX-2 Foam Model for yourself, here's a link where you can get it from:  http://stores.homestead.com/fancyfoam/StoreFront.bok

Held October 7th through October 11th, 2009, Tucson Arizona. Tucson Aerobatic Shootout:  This event drew the top RC Pilots from around the world for 5 days of intense competition.  With  a $100,000 plus purse (money and prizes) at stake, it is certainly the premier RC event in the US.  I (Al) attended the event Friday through Sunday and witnessed some extreme flying.  Wednesday through Sunday was IMAC style sequences.  Saturday and Sunday also had 3-sets of 4-minute freestyles... they were totally awesome!  I took almost 6000 pictures and am presenting them to you in three groupings, one for each of the three days I was there.
